Поняття об'єкта, його властивості і методи Python

Додано: 27 квітня 2023
Предмет: Інформатика, 8 клас
Тест виконано: 138 разів
16 запитань
Запитання 1

Які властивості може мати кнопка?

варіанти відповідей

Колір фону

Колір шрифту

Відображення кнопки у вікні

Розмір шрифту

Запитання 2

Щоб створена кнопка реагувала на натискання потрібно:

варіанти відповідей

Задати для кнопки текст

Записатина початку програми команду на кшалт "Якщо кнопку натиснуто, виконати певну дію"

Запрограмувати подію натискання кнопки

Запитання 3

В елементі програмного коду

but1=Button(text="Клацніть мене")

but1.pack()

text це ...

варіанти відповідей

метод

об'єкт

властивість

конструктор

Запитання 4

Яким службовим словом починають описувати функцію?

варіанти відповідей

button

front

def

pack

Запитання 5

Для створення такого напису на жовтому фоні, потрібно використати наступні параметри:

варіанти відповідей

label['text'] = 'Right Click'

label['bg'] = 'yellow'

label['fg'] = 'blue'

label['text'] = 'Left Click'

label['bg'] = 'blue'

label['fg'] = 'yellow'

button['text'] = 'Right Click'

button['bg'] = 'yellow'

button['fg'] = 'blue'

button['text'] = 'Left Click'

button['bg'] = 'blue'

button['fg'] = 'yellow'

Запитання 6

Який розмір шрифту буде використано в написі:

lab1 = Label(root, text = 'Привіт, друже!', width = 20, font = 'Arial 18', bg = 'yellow', fg = 'grey')

варіанти відповідей

20

18

не описано розмір

Запитання 7

Що робить 4 рядок коду?


from tkinter import*

root = Tk()

root.title('Розвязувач')

root.geometry('250x200')

lab = Label(root, text = 'Введіть приклад', font = 'Arial 18')

lab.place(x=20, y=10)

варіанти відповідей

визначає назву вікна

визначає розмір вікна

визначає розміщення напису у вікні

Запитання 8

Щоб розмістити напис у вікні, потрібно створити новий об'єкт типу: 

варіанти відповідей

 Button

 Entry

 Label

tkinter

Запитання 9

Після виконання команди:

label=Label(text='Я навчаюсь у 8 класі', bg='green', fg='pink', font='MonotypeCorsiva 16')

буде створено напис...

варіанти відповідей

Зеленими літерами на жовтому фоні із текстом Я навчаюсь у 8 класі, шрифт Arial, розмір символів 14

Рожевими літерами на зеленому фоні із текстом Я навчаюсь у 8 класі, шрифт Monotype Corsiva, розмір символів 16

Зеленими літерами на рожевому фоні із текстом Я навчаюсь у 8 класі, шрифт Monotype Corsiva, розмір символів 16

нічого не створиться

Запитання 10

Для створення кнопки потрібно виконати команду:

варіанти відповідей

ім’я_змінної = Entry()

ім’я_змінної = Tk()

ім’я_змінної = Button()

Запитання 11

Для створення текстового поля потрібно вибрати для нього ім’я та виконати команду:

варіанти відповідей

<ім’я_змінної> = Text()

<ім’я_змінної> = Tk()

<ім’я_змінної> = Entry()

Запитання 12

root.bind(‘<подія>’, <ім’я_обробника_події>) -

варіанти відповідей

це команда пов'язування обробника події з вікном, що має ім'я root

це обробник події, що відбувається з вікном

це вікно для виведення на екран текстових повідомлень

Запитання 13

Оберіть код, який у разі натискання кнопки ОК виводить повідомлення Hello!

варіанти відповідей
Запитання 14

Метод,що задає місце знаходження кнопки:

варіанти відповідей

motion

geometry

place

Запитання 15

Метод для отримання даних з текстового поля

варіанти відповідей

plase

entry

get()

Запитання 16

Вкажіть будь ласка яким номером позначено назву кнопки

варіанти відповідей

1

2

3

4

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ест